Q.
Hello Dr Thorne, I would love to hear from you and I hope you can help me, I would really like to know what the component which goes into making Invisalign is made up of? A.
Hello and thank you for asking. It is not the usual type of question we get get here but I’m only too happy to provide you with an answer. It is a proprietary construction of biocompatible medical grade thermoplastic. This has been improved over the years and now is known as SmartTrack. This means that elasticity has improved, along with comfort and improved predictability and control. I hope this helps you decide which system is best for you. Best wishes. Dr Adam Thorne.
